Pine Bark Mulch Installation in Honolulu, HI
Pine bark mulch installation is a popular landscaping service that involves applying a layer of finely shredded pine bark around trees, shrubs, flower beds, and other garden areas. This type of mulch helps to retain soil moisture, suppress weeds, and improve the overall appearance of outdoor spaces. It is suitable for a variety of projects, including garden bed refreshes, new planting areas, and landscape upgrades, making it a versatile choice for homeowners looking to enhance their property's curb appeal and health of plantings.
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the mulch installation, such as the depth of coverage and the amount of mulch needed for their specific areas. It’s also important to consider the existing landscape conditions, including soil type and plant compatibility, to ensure the mulch provides the desired benefits. Proper installation can contribute to healthier plants, reduced maintenance, and a tidy, attractive landscape that complements the overall design of the property.

Pine Bark Mulch Installation Questions
What are the benefits of Pine Bark Mulch? Pine bark mulch helps retain soil moisture, suppress weeds, and improve the appearance of garden beds and landscaping areas.
Which projects commonly use Pine Bark Mulch? It is often used around trees, shrubs, flower beds, and landscape borders to enhance aesthetics and protect plant roots.
How is Pine Bark Mulch installed? The mulch is spread evenly over prepared soil, typically in a layer of 2 to 4 inches, to provide a clean, finished look.
What should property owners consider before installation? Ensure the area is cleared of debris and weeds, and choose the appropriate mulch depth for the specific landscape needs.
